Housing
The housing market plays a significant role in determining the cost of living.
| Metric | Campbell | Long prairie |
|---|---|---|
| Housing Index | 180.0 | 103 |
| Median Home Price | $1,570,000 | $245,000 |
| Average Rent (2 BR Apartment) | $2968 | $1560 |
| Average Rent (2 BR House) | $3226 | $1696 |
Housing Comparison: Campbell vs Long prairie
- In Campbell, the median home price is higher at $1,570,000, while in Long prairie it is $245,000.
- Renting a two-bedroom apartment costs more in Campbell at $2,968 than in Long prairie at $1,560.
